What affects the price

Installing an EV charger isn't a one-size-fits-all job. The final number depends on your home’s existing electrical panel capacity and whether you have enough room for a new circuit breaker. Distance is another big factor; running conduit from your panel to the garage or driveway adds labor and material costs. Choosing a hardwired unit versus a plug-in model also shifts the price. If your panel needs an upgrade to handle the extra load, that will be the largest variable.

What's involved in a Level 2 EV charger installation?

A Level 2 EV charger installation requires a dedicated 240-volt circuit. A licensed electrician will assess your home's electrical system. They'll determine the best location for the charger and run the necessary wiring. The charger is then mounted and connected, followed by a system test.
